From 256d06b67cbe9729f3fa1f56dd1077fd668f71e4 Mon Sep 17 00:00:00 2001 From: asofold Date: Thu, 4 Dec 2014 03:09:17 +0100 Subject: [PATCH] Add permissions for JourneyMap/VoxelMap. --- .../neatmonster/nocheatplus/permissions/Permissions.java | 6 ++++-- NCPPlugin/src/main/resources/plugin.yml | 7 +++++++ 2 files changed, 11 insertions(+), 2 deletions(-) diff --git a/NCPCore/src/main/java/fr/neatmonster/nocheatplus/permissions/Permissions.java b/NCPCore/src/main/java/fr/neatmonster/nocheatplus/permissions/Permissions.java index 1bbcfc83..1b7bcd52 100644 --- a/NCPCore/src/main/java/fr/neatmonster/nocheatplus/permissions/Permissions.java +++ b/NCPCore/src/main/java/fr/neatmonster/nocheatplus/permissions/Permissions.java @@ -25,6 +25,7 @@ public class Permissions { // Command permissions. public static final String COMMAND = NOCHEATPLUS + ".command"; public static final String COMMAND_COMMANDS = COMMAND + ".commands"; + public static final String COMMAND_DEBUG = COMMAND + ".debug"; public static final String COMMAND_EXEMPT = COMMAND + ".exempt"; public static final String COMMAND_EXEMPTIONS = COMMAND + ".exemptions"; public static final String COMMAND_INFO = COMMAND + ".info"; @@ -161,8 +162,9 @@ public class Permissions { public static final String ZOMBE_CHEAT = ZOMBE + ".cheat"; public static final String ZOMBE_FLY = ZOMBE + ".fly"; public static final String ZOMBE_NOCLIP = ZOMBE + ".noclip"; - + private static final String JOURNEY = MODS + ".journey"; public static final String JOURNEY_RADAR = JOURNEY + ".radar"; - public static final String JOURNEY_CAVE = JOURNEY + ".cavemap"; + public static final String JOURNEY_CAVE = JOURNEY + ".cavemap"; + } diff --git a/NCPPlugin/src/main/resources/plugin.yml b/NCPPlugin/src/main/resources/plugin.yml index ae0924bf..ea33848f 100644 --- a/NCPPlugin/src/main/resources/plugin.yml +++ b/NCPPlugin/src/main/resources/plugin.yml @@ -195,6 +195,13 @@ permissions: description: Allow the player to use CJB's radar. nocheatplus.mods.cjb.xray: description: Allow the player to use CJB's xray. + nocheatplus.mods.journey: + description: Allow players too use mapping features of the JourneyMap mod (Same codes as VoxelMap). + children: + nocheatplus.mods.journey.radar: + description: Radar features (JourneyMap, VoxelMap). + nocheatplus.mods.journey.cavemap: + description: Cave map features (JourneyMap, VoxelMap). nocheatplus.mods.minecraftautomap: description: Allow the player to use the Minecraft AutoMap mod. children: